Custom 6mm BR Norma Old Glory
Hey all, I put this together in the spring with the intentions of shooting some matches through the summer. I got it all tuned in and with kids events, I just didn't have time to go. This one is ready to go and can compete tomorrow guaranteed! Built in a trued and blue printed Remington stainless short action. Bolt squared and sako extractor. Barrel is sendero contour bartlien 1:8 twist finished at 28" plus muzzle break. Stock is McMillan A5 "old glory" and has been cleanly bedded. Trigger is a jewel set at 16oz. It is topped with a night force competition 15-55x52 with mounts and rings to match. Action and barrel was bead blasted when built and is very sharp. I have load developed with lapua 105 scenars. It has had exactly 107 rounds fired. I have 50 pcs of lapua once fired brass that will come with it along with Redding dies. All load data as well. 4,000 FTF or shipped on buyers dime.
